Company Background


APenergy is a technical consulting firm that helps manufacturing plants save energy and reduce operating costs of their major energy-using systems, such as compressed air, process cooling, controls, motor-pump groups, and other industrial processes.

We identify, evaluate, and help implement quick payback solutions, as well as long-term capital projects.

For more than 35 years APenergy has been a nation's leader in troubleshooting and improving compressed air systems.

The practical experience we have gained from completing more than 1,500 system assessments and 900 project installations allows us to address most any compressed air system problem, regardless of air system type, size, or industry.


Fast forward to the last four years, more than 80% of our revenues are performance-based and contingent on metered results of our projects.

We operate the country's most successful service that evaluates and implements savings projects to customers through the creative use of utility incentives to pay for our services.

The key function we provide is comprehensive project management while increasing project KPIs so our clients feel like we are an extension of their energy management departments.
